Organic Letters | 2013

Stereocontrolled synthesis of the AB rings of samaderine C.

David J. Burns; Stefan Mommer; Peter O’Brien; Richard Taylor; Adrian C. Whitwood; Shuji Hachisu

A concise synthesis of the AB rings of samaderine C (12 steps, 8 isolation steps, 7.8% overall yield), a quassinoid with antifeedant and insecticidal activity, is described. The development of the first general approach to the trans-1,2-diol A-ring motif in samaderine C and other quassinoids is a key feature. The trans-1,2-diol is crafted via stereoselective α-hydroxylation (of a silyl enol ether) and reduction, a strategy that has much potential for quassinoid synthesis.


Bioorganic & Medicinal Chemistry Letters | 2017

Herbicidal aryldiones incorporating a 5-methoxy-[1,2,5]triazepane ring

Tomas Smejkal; Shuji Hachisu; James Nicholas Scutt; Nigel James Willetts; Danielle Sayer; Laura Wildsmith; Sophie Oliver; Caroline Thompson; Michel Muehlebach

Novel 2-aryl-cyclic-1,3-diones containing a 5-methoxy-[1,2,5]triazepane unit were explored towards an effective and wheat safe control of grass weeds. Their preparation builds on the ease of synthetic access to 7-membered heterocyclic [1,2,5]triazepane building blocks. Substitution and pattern hopping in the phenyl moiety revealed structure-activity relationships in good agreement with previously disclosed observations amongst the pinoxaden family of acetyl-CoA carboxylase inhibitors. In light of basic physicochemical, enzyme inhibitory and binding site properties, the N-methoxy functionality effectively acts as a bioisostere of the ether group in the seven-membered hydrazine ring.
